This study aims to conduct a critical analysis related to innovative learning methods that can be applied in learning Hindu Religious Education. Hindu Religious Education is a subject that must be given to Hindu students at all levels wherever they are which has been regulated in the constitution. The role of the Hindu Religious Education teacher is necessary in order to convey a complete understanding of Hindu Religious Education to students, and teachers need learning methods in the process. The dasa dharma learning method, with four new methods namely dharma carita, dharma lila, dharma kriya and dharma brata can be an innovation made by teachers in learning. This research is a qualitative research with a literature study approach, meaning that the data obtained are secondary sources from articles, journals or books which are then analyzed by data reduction, data presentation and conclusions. The results of this study are that the application of the dasa dharma method will greatly assist teachers in inculcating Hindu Religious Education material which generally consists of tattwa, susila, dan upacara. The dharma carita method can be used in providing material related to the cultivation of ethics/susila such as itihasa/purana stories. Meanwhile, with the dharma lila method, material related to tattwa can be provided, such as an understanding of the panca sradhas with the game of snakes and ladders of belief. The dharma kriya method can be used in materials related to upacara such as training in making ceremonial tools, then the dharma brata method to practice self-control and grow spiritual intelligence in students
